Frequently Asked Questions about Tonasket

How much are Studio apartments in Tonasket?

There are currently 3 Studio Apartments in Tonasket with rent ranges from $995 to $1,565 with an average price of $1,273.

What is the current price range for One Bedroom Tonasket Apartments for rent?

Today's rental pricing for One Bedroom Apartments in Tonasket ranges from $654 to $1,850 with an average monthly rent of $1,429.

What does renting a Two Bedroom Apartment in Tonasket cost?

The monthly rent prices of Two Bedroom Apartments currently available in Tonasket range from $950 to $2,350. Today's average rental price for Two Bedrooms here is $1,898.
